New Software Model Reveals How Coupling Degrades System Quality
The article introduces a model to measure the quality of software components and overall software systems. The model focuses on the internal strength and connections between components. Experiments with software engineering teams showed that excessive connections between components can lower their quality and the overall system quality. This model helps identify and eliminate unnecessary connections in software design that can degrade system quality.